Default Problem with gas "starvation"

Recently had a factory rebuilt engine installed in my 1997 Electra Glide Ultra Classic - Fuel Injection, and we took it out yesterday (temperature 9Celsius) stalled at lights, started after 5th try, kept going and then start spluttering on highway, stalling and jump starting by inself. Cleared up after a few jolts and then repeated the same thing in about 40 kms. and then again after another 50 kms for a few more times. I was at half a tank so topped up and put in some stabilizer and then seemed to do the trick. Then tonight took it out, and after about 40 kms the same thing, this time happened 3x within 10 blocks. Anyone experienced this before? I have to take it in for the 1600 kms oil change in about 1 month, but would like to sort this out before then. Some suggestions have been that it is a fuel injection problem, or fuel filter problem in the gas tank. I am also looking for a HD manual for my bike.[&o]

Default RE: Problem with gas "starvation"

When it stallsopen the gas cap and see if you hear air rushing in the tank. You could have a blocked vent. Did you change the gas cap?? I'm not sure if you have a fuse or Circuit breaker for your fuel pump, also check all your grounds or "earths" as you guys call them. Check all other connections as well.
